Spring Boot ObjectMapper 不返回 null 字段

Spring Boot About 453 words

需求

在使用ObjectMapper或正常Controller返回时,过滤掉值为null的字段。

代码

主要是objectMapper.setSerializationInclusion设置为JsonInclude.Include.NON_NULL

@Configuration
public class ObjectMapperConfig {

    @Bean
    public ObjectMapper objectMapper(Jackson2ObjectMapperBuilder builder) {
        ObjectMapper objectMapper = builder.createXmlMapper(false).build();
        objectMapper.setSerializationInclusion(JsonInclude.Include.NON_NULL);
        return objectMapper;
    }

}
Views: 604 · Posted: 2024-04-05

————        END        ————

Give me a Star, Thanks:)

https://github.com/fendoudebb/LiteNote

扫描下方二维码关注公众号和小程序↓↓↓

扫描下方二维码关注公众号和小程序↓↓↓


Today On History
Browsing Refresh